Teletoon at Night (formerly The Detour) is a Canadian English-language late night programming block airing on Teletoon, which is owned by Corus Entertainment. The block features programming targeted towards older teen and adult audiences.

It is similar in format to Adult Swim, the late night block on Cartoon Network. The block's French counterpart, Télétoon la nuit, airs on Teletoon's French-language channel, Télétoon.[1]

History

Teletoon at Night's roots lie in two former program blocks that aired on Teletoon: the teenage-oriented block formally known as "The Detour," and the adult-oriented "Teletoon Unleashed" block, which had been dropped due to lack of new content. In September 2004, the two blocks were amalgamated, with all-new branding created by Guru Studio.[2] For the start of the 2006–07 season, a new Friday night companion block, F-Night, debuted, featuring a slightly different lineup, mainly comedy series from Adult Swim (such as Tom Goes to the Mayor and Squidbillies).

In 2007, most of the shows that were featured on "F-Night" were removed to make room for the "F'N Good Movie" (later "Detour Movie") segment, which aired on Thursdays and Fridays at 10:00 p.m. EST, followed by a repeat of the earlier movie telecast. Movies shown during this block were mostly animated or were derived from comic books (such as Scott Pilgrim vs. the World) and other animated series. A majority of the films were designed to target an older teenage or adult audience, which was the intended target and purpose of the block. If the movie did not fill the entire two- to 212-hour block, animated shorts (such as short films from The Animatrix) were used to fill the remaining time.

On September 1, 2008, the block amended its name to Teletoon Detour. In 2009, the Teletoon at Night branding was introduced but as the name of a separate block; with Teletoon at Night airing on weekdays and Teletoon Detour airing on weekends. In 2010, the "Detour" branding was dropped entirely. In the fall, Teletoon at Night's weekend schedule was branded as Fred at Night, hosted by Fearless Fred of Toronto radio station CFNY-FM. From December 31, 2010, Teletoon at Night's weekend schedule was rebranded as Double Night. In recent years, "Fred at Night" moved to Thursdays and, with the launch of the Canadian version of Adult Swim (via the Canadian version of Cartoon Network), most of the original programming from the U.S. service has migrated to its Canadian counterpart.[3]

In the summer of 2014, movies on Saturdays were branded as the "Saturday Night Funhouse Double Feature".[4] Meanwhile, Teletoon acquired broadcast rights to The Awesomes, a Hulu original series.[5] In October 2014, Bento Box Entertainment, the studio that produces The Awesomes, announced they would be producing a new slate of shows for Teletoon at Night.[6] In the same month, Blue Ant Media, Mondo Media, and Corus announced that Teletoon at Night would air a new series featuring shorts from Bite on Mondo, a program in which content creators pitched ideas for new shows. During the week of September 1, 2015, it was announced on-air that, on that date, several of the block's shows (including original series Fugget About It), will move to Adult Swim.[10][11][12] In a press release posted on September 3, 2015, it was announced that the block will now air Mondays through Thursdays starting at 10:00 p.m, with a movie at 11:00 p.m. Teletoon's Superfan Friday block will expand in Teletoon at Night's place.[10][13] It was later announced in December 2015 that, starting on January 4, 2016, Teletoon at Night will be adding more movies to their schedule and their remaining shows will move over to Adult Swim.[14]

In February 2016, several shows that were airing on Adult Swim began airing on Teletoon at Night. On February 24, 2016, it was announced in a press release that the seventh season of Archer would air on both blocks.[15] In the same month, Teletoon at Night's website revealed that its Fred at Night segment would be discontinued after six years, with the final installment airing on February 25, 2016.[14] On March 23, 2016, it was revealed that Archer's seventh season would instead air on Teletoon at Night, although the season premiere did air in simulcast on Adult Swim.[16] From 2016-2017, the block was broadcast Monday to Thursday nights from 8:00 p.m to 3:00 a.m and from 9:00 p.m to 3:00 a.m on weekends.

Since September 2017, the block airs nightly from 9:00 p.m to 3:00 a.m.
